Sample responsibilities

Source passive candidates on LinkedIn and outreach against your ICP
Screen inbound applicants against role scorecards and route shortlists
Schedule interview loops across panelists, candidates, and time zones
Maintain ATS hygiene — stages, notes, and rejection comms
Run onboarding paperwork, I-9 collection, and first-day logistics
Track top-of-funnel metrics and report weekly on pipeline health
